My bike is a "Touring" Ron Cooper: from him with eyelets for fenders and racks, as well as milder angles for a more comfortable ride. I have not seen another, just racing angles and no factory eyelets. Anyone know if this is rare?
Mine is also a touring or sport touring model.
It has a single pair of eyelets front and rear and accommodates true to size 700c x 35 Paselas I am running on it.
They add to the great ride of the bike and give me the cush I prefer for my style of riding.
I am not sure the exact angles but guessing between 72 & 73. Will have to check that out.
It also has Nervex lugs. The paint is a bit rough and tubing sticker is missing as is head tube decal but does anyone know if he mostly used Reynolds 531 tubing?
It came to me as a frame/fork only & I built it up with an assorted mix of parts I had on hand.
It would also be nice to know the date it was made. I am guessing late 70's. It has a 3 digit serial number beginning with 7.
